Subject: [PATCH] hid: cp2112: select GPIOLIB_IRQCHIP instead of depending on it

GPIOLIB_IRQCHIP is not visible to user, so we can't depend on it.

Depend on GPIOLIB but select GPIOLIB_IRQCHIP.

Signed-off-by: Bartosz Golaszewski <bgolaszewski@...libre.com>
---
 drivers/hid/Kconfig | 3 ++-
 1 file changed, 2 insertions(+), 1 deletion(-)

diff --git a/drivers/hid/Kconfig b/drivers/hid/Kconfig
index 1aeb80e..00e2809 100644
--- a/drivers/hid/Kconfig
+++ b/drivers/hid/Kconfig
@@ -214,7 +214,8 @@ config HID_CMEDIA
 
 config HID_CP2112
 	tristate "Silicon Labs CP2112 HID USB-to-SMBus Bridge support"
-	depends on USB_HID && I2C && GPIOLIB && GPIOLIB_IRQCHIP
+	depends on USB_HID && I2C && GPIOLIB
+	select GPIOLIB_IRQCHIP
 	---help---
 	Support for Silicon Labs CP2112 HID USB to SMBus Master Bridge.
 	This is a HID device driver which registers as an i2c adapter
